Today’s Guest –
Hayden Dawes embodies a passionate commitment to mental health equity, particularly advocating for LGBTQ+ People of Colour. With over eight years of clinical social work experience across diverse sectors, including community mental health and veterans’ health, he brings a wealth of expertise. As a Robert Wood Johnson Foundation Health Policy Research Scholar, Hayden spearheads innovative policies to foster inclusion and justice. Through teaching and professional development, he champions cultural humility and equity in mental health services.
